Dealadash Is Best of Three for Trainer Jones

Share

Trainer Paul Jones will send out three of the six runners in tonight’s ninth, a $13,550 allowance at 350 yards.

In terms of earnings, the most accomplished of Jones’ entrants is Dealadash.

A 4-year-old Dash Thru Traffic gelding, Dealadash has won five of 25 and earned more than $153,029. A California-bred owned by Jones in partnership, Dealadash seeks his first victory in his fifth start of 2004.

The other two that Jones will run are Red Hot Blitzer, a five-time winner, and Coronas Prospect, who will be making his second start of the year.

Special Cartel, Chicks Jet Baby and Azyoucansee complete the field.
